Tsallis entropy and entanglement constraints in multi-qubit systems

Quantum Physics 2010-06-30 v2

Abstract

We show that the restricted sharability and distribution of multi-qubit entanglement can be characterized by Tsallis-qq entropy. We first provide a class of bipartite entanglement measures named Tsallis-qq entanglement, and provide its analytic formula in two-qubit systems for 1q41 \leq q \leq 4. For 2q32 \leq q \leq 3, we show a monogamy inequality of multi-qubit entanglement in terms of Tsallis-qq entanglement, and we also provide a polygamy inequality using Tsallis-qq entropy for 1q21 \leq q \leq 2 and 3q43 \leq q \leq 4.
